Output 663227ee828cd7cfedbd8244ff2205a9d7de7d1d518bbec4e48a97c47b99d4c8:69

value
31697
script pubkey
OP_0 OP_PUSHBYTES_20 d1aa0f9422b01a1b1084e7849fdcf0eaaa072661
address
bc1q6x4ql9pzkqdpkyyyu7zflh8sa24qwfnp4dcwsp
transaction
663227ee828cd7cfedbd8244ff2205a9d7de7d1d518bbec4e48a97c47b99d4c8
confirmations
130
spent
false